London Terrace Towers, 470 West 24th Street, #2C
Last Sold on Nov 4, 2011 for $995,000 ($829 / ft2)
This was
6.6% less
than the last listed price of $1,065,000
($888 / ft2)
2 beds, 2 baths, 1,200 / ft2
Request Update